LysosomesLysosomes

Characteristics:◦Acidic interior◦Contains hydrolytic enzymes◦Surrounded by a membrane

Lysosomes are analogous to the human stomach; the pH within a lysosome is very acidic & the enzymes within work most effectively in this environment.

Functions:Functions:Carrying out digestionrecycling of cellular organellesthe breakdown of viruses and other cellular

invaders

Single-celled organisms, such as amoebas, use lysosomes to digest their food since they have no process for extracellular digestion.

Lysosomal storage Lysosomal storage diseasesdiseases

Undegraded material accumulates within the lysosomes of affected individuals

Most of these diseases result from deficiencies in single lysosomal enzymes.◦Example: Gaucher’s disease

Gaucher diseaseGaucher diseaseMost common of lysosomal storage

diseases

Genetic disorder where there’s accumulation of lipids in cells and organs

results from a mutation in the gene that encodes a lysosomal enzyme required for the breakdown of glycolipids.

Some Signs & Symptoms:Some Signs & Symptoms:Enlarged liver and spleenLow number of red blood cells

(anemia)easy bruising caused by a decrease

in blood plateletslung diseasebone abnormalities such as bone

pain, fractures, and arthritis.Problems with central nervous

system
